Just trying to get a little feedback on how we can improve our Super Sprockets....
Our current "regular" Super Sprockets have 4 mounting patterns on them...
1) The Large Bolt Circle 8 MM 9 hole mount. (HD Factory Rag mount)
2) The Small bolt Circle 6 MM 9 hole mount.
3) The Large Bolt Circle 6 MM 9 hole mount (basically reuse holes from #1 above BUT use 6 MM bolts instead of 8 MM bolts).
4) The direct to disc brake hub 6 bolts holes.
I am wondering how often (if ever on the "newer" engine kits) is #2 used?
If #2 above is no longer regularly used, I was thinking about removing those mounting holes from our "regular" Super Sprockets adding the (2) Manic Mechanic Mounting patterns and maybe even throwing in a pattern or two from the Grubee HD hubs as well....
I think the Manic mounting patterns will work on our current sprockets as they are now but some of the holes will be very close together....Not necessarily a problem from the structural standpoint but more from an aesthetics standpoint (people tend to get a little uneasy if there isn't a lot of "meat" around bolt holes).
